Output ef528a18156035cdf6d0bc78be80fe2f3c9d41e7c5ef93729aadbc9043381772:1

value
21018000
script pubkey
OP_0 OP_PUSHBYTES_20 3b8927c5d06bf19a595cb777a58d22fb8cea5b08
address
bc1q8wyj03wsd0ce5k2ukam6trfzlwxw5kcgqzlkgn
transaction
ef528a18156035cdf6d0bc78be80fe2f3c9d41e7c5ef93729aadbc9043381772